New Delhi: President Pranab Mukherjee has condoled the loss of lives in an explosion of a GAIL gas pipeline in Andhra Pradesh on Friday.

In his message to ESL Narasimhan, the Governor of Andhra Pradesh, the President has said: "I am extremely saddened to learn about the explosion of a GAIL gas pipeline in East Godavari district of Andhra Pradesh in which some persons have lost their lives and many others are injured.”

"I am sure that the state government and other agencies are taking necessary steps to provide urgent medical assistance to the injured and all possible aid to the bereaved families, who have lost their near and dear ones," he said.

"Please convey my heartfelt condolences to the families of the deceased. I wish speedy recovery to the injured persons," he added.

At least 14 people were killed and seven others injured in a fire following a blast in a gas pipeline belonging to GAIL in Andhra Pradesh's East Godavari district this morning.

Gas Authority of India Limited (GAIL) is the country's largest state-owned natural gas processing and distribution company.
